Do Gucci boots run true to size?

Gucci boots often run close to true to size, but the “right” size depends heavily on the specific style, materials, and how you plan to wear them. Many shoppers find Gucci ankle boots fit best in their usual US/EU size when the leather is supple and the toe shape is not overly narrow. That said, structured silhouettes and tapered toes can feel snug—especially across the forefoot—so sizing can vary from “true” to “runs small” depending on the boot.

What typically affects Gucci boot sizing?

Toe shape and last: Pointed or almond-toe Gucci boots can feel tighter than rounded-toe options even in the same labeled size. If your toes feel compressed during a try-on, consider going up a half size when available.

Leather stiffness and lining: Smooth leather and lined styles may start firmer and loosen slightly with wear, while softer leather can feel comfortable immediately. If you’re between sizes, a snug-but-not-painful fit can work if the leather has room to break in.

Socks and inserts: Planning to wear thicker socks or add an insole for arch support can push you toward sizing up. If you prefer thin socks and a sleek fit, your regular size is often the safest starting point.

How to choose your best size before buying

If possible, try on late in the day (feet are slightly larger), walk on a hard surface, and check for heel slip. A small amount of heel movement can be normal in new boots, but persistent slipping usually means the boot is too big or the instep doesn’t match your foot. How do you break in Gucci leather boots without damaging them?

Wear them indoors in short sessions with thin socks, then gradually increase time. A leather conditioner and a professional stretch (if needed) can help relieve pressure points without warping the shape.
